Q. Dadabhai Nauroji, the greatest exponent of the theory of ‘Drain of wealth’ called the economic exploitation of India (a) Evil of all evils (b) A continuous fleecing (c) A continuous British invasion (d) None of these Ans: (c) A continuous British invasion
